Albanese unveils long-awaited response to landmark gambling reform report by anoxiousweed in AustralianPolitics

[–]anoxiousweed[S] 6 points7 points  (0 children)

In short:

Gambling ads would be partially restricted on television and radio, with opt-out rules for online promotions and a ban in stadiums and on jerseys under reforms announced by Labor.

Prime Minister Anthony Albanese used a speech at the National Press Club to confirm the government will release its formal response to the You Win Some, You Lose More’ report by late Labor MP Peta Murphy.

What's next?

Harm minimisation advocates are already accusing the government of taking a watered-down approach to the report, which called for a total online gambling ad ban.
